- While I think it is not a perfect movie, It is well-shot and has a tight storyline. It is a hard one to adapt given how beloved it is, but has strong characters overall, and a strong portrayal of trauma (esp in that one, terrifying bathroom scene).
- Read the book first, as I always have to but the movie held up to the book. I LOVE IT WHEN THAT HAPPENS 😍.
- It builds an unsettlingly uncomfortable narrative with a truly chilling villain. It doesn't get everything right, considering how long the Stephen King novel is, but it is a pretty good adaptation.
- It is really unsettling at times even if the movie relies on jumpscares one too many times. Thought the central story and group of friends was really well done. They felt like real kids that have experienced real horror in their life. Pennywise is definitely nightmare fuel though.

IT Review
7_/10_
As a coming of age parable, IT succeeds at being both horrifying and emotionally-resonant, even while adapting only half of King's original story.
